Understanding your skin is the first step toward effective skincare. Each person’s skin is different, and recognizing your skin type—whether it’s dry, oily, sensitive, or combination—will help guide your choices when it comes to skincare products. For example, if you have dry skin, you should look for moisturizers that contain nourishing ingredients like hyaluronic acid or glycerin. Oily skin, on the other hand, benefits from lightweight products that do not clog pores and keep oil production in check.

Exfoliating is another essential part of skincare. It helps eliminate dead skin cells that can clog pores and cause dullness. Regular exfoliation promotes a brighter and smoother complexion. However, it’s important to avoid over-exfoliating, as it can irritate the skin. Once or twice a week is generally sufficient for most skin types. Choose a mild exfoliant with gentle ingredients to prevent damage to your skin’s surface.
Moisturizing is vital for every skin type. Even if you have oily skin, you still need moisture to maintain balance. Skipping moisturizer can lead to dry patches, and the skin may overcompensate by producing more oil. For dry skin, opt for heavier creams, while lightweight lotions or gels work well for oily skin. Find a product that suits your skin type and apply it daily to lock in moisture and protect your skin from environmental damage.
One of the most important steps in skin care is protecting your skin from the sun. UV rays are one of the leading causes of premature aging, fine lines, and even skin cancer. Wearing sunscreen daily is essential, even if you’re indoors or it’s cloudy outside. Apply a broad-spectrum sunscreen with an SPF of at least 30, and be sure to reapply every two hours when outdoors.
